General description

2-(2′-Di-tert-butylphosphine)biphenylpalladium(II) acetate is a novel, air- and moisture-and thermally stable catalyst.

Application

Precatalyst for Buchwald-Hartwig amination reaction.
It can be used as a pre-catalyst for the amination of aryl chlorides. It can also be used to prepare N-methyl-6-heterocyclic-1-oxoisoindoline derivatives via Buchwald-Hartwig amination reaction of N-methyl-6- bromoisoindoline-1-one with different amines under microwave condition.
